
High-rise "Gallileo"
Dresdner Bank, Frankfurt
The design for the high-rise "Gallileo" is based on a triple-tiered structure that is set back from the block edge and was developed from the urban planning situation.

The regular floor plan distinguishes between the two different height, transparent office towers and the massive core. With the employee casino, the restaurants, the exhibition area in the low-rise building made of natural stone, and through the English Theatre in the basement, an important contribution is made to connecting public uses and office spaces in a high-rise.
